Evangelist Mildred Wooden was a servant of the Lord Jesus Christ.  She was born the daughter of the late Reverend Joseph and Emma Mae Mitchell on January 19, 1947, in Sylvester, Georgia.

She attended the public schools of Worth County, graduating with high honors from J. W. Holley High School.

She came to know the Lord at the early age of eight years old.  As she continued her walk with the Lord in later years, she co-founded Jesus Christ Gospel Prayer House of Holiness Deliverance Church in Poulan, Georgia with her husband.   Evangelist Wooden was an instrument that God used to bring many souls to Him.  She also helped establish numerous churches in the Albany area.  The anointing of God that was upon her life affected the lives of many others.  She was a woman of faith and a prayer warrior who dedicated her life to praising and glorifying God.

Evangelist Wooden was a devoted wife and loving mother of eight wonderful children.  She was steadfast in fostering a Christian home filled with love, joy, and strong values.  Through the years, she was a wife of noble character and a mother whose children called her blessed.

Although there were many trials and tribulations in her life, she won her victory and went home to be with Jesus.  She departed this earthly life on Friday, October 25, 2019, at Orlando Heath Central Hospital in Orlando, Florida.  Along with her parents and husband, she was  preceded in death by five siblings, Joseph Mitchell, Clifford Mitchell, Alice Mae Allen, Emma Bell Rush, and Edward Mitchell.
